    Volkswagen Car Key Replacement: A Comprehensive Guide

    Losing or breaking a car key is an experience every automobile owner dreads. For Volkswagen owners, the key replacement procedure can be a bit different from other brand names, given the technology and intricacies involved in their key systems. This guide intends to provide in-depth details on the Volkswagen car key replacement procedure, types of keys, costs included, and frequently asked questions.

    Understanding Volkswagen Keys

    Volkswagen keys have actually progressed substantially for many years, moving from traditional keys to complicated electronic systems that enhance security and convenience. There are generally three kinds of keys used in Volkswagen lorries:

    Types of Volkswagen Keys

    Key Type
    Description
    Compatibility

    Traditional Key
    Basic metal key without electronic features.
    Older VW models (pre-1998)

    Transponder Key
    Key with a chip that interacts with the car’s immobilizer, improving security.
    Many models (1998 – 2015)

    Smart Key
    Key fob that permits keyless entry and push-start ignition.
    More recent designs (2016 onward)

    Traditional Key Replacement

    Replacing a conventional Volkswagen key generally includes going to a locksmith or Volkswagen car dealership. The cost is typically lower compared to more recent keys, hovering around ₤ 50 to ₤ 100, based upon the locksmith professional’s rates and your place.

    Transponder Key Replacement

    Transponder keys need specialized shows to connect the key with the lorry’s immobilizer system. Here’s a general breakdown of the replacement procedure:

    • Lost Key: If all keys are lost, a new transponder key can cost anywhere from ₤ 150 to ₤ 300.
    • Key Duplication: If you have an existing key, duplication may only cost between ₤ 75 and ₤ 150, depending on the service provider.

    Smart Key Replacement

    Smart keys are the most highly advanced, hence the most pricey to change. The following describes the normal costs:

    • Lost Key Replacement: Ranges from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500, depending upon the design and features such as distance entry or remote start.
    • Replicate Smart Key: Usually costs in between ₤ 150 and ₤ 300.

    Key Replacement Process

    Replacing a Volkswagen key can generally be completed in a few steps. The method can differ based on the key type:

    For Traditional and Transponder Keys:

    1. Visit a Professional: Choose a trusted locksmith or Volkswagen car dealership.
    2. Supply Vehicle Information: The VIN (Vehicle Identification Number), evidence of ownership, and recognition will be needed.
    3. Cutting the Key: The key is cut utilizing code or the existing key.
    4. Programming (if suitable): For transponder keys, the new key is set to the car’s immobilizer.

    For Smart Keys:

    1. Contact VW Dealer: Smart keys need to be replaced through a Volkswagen car dealership due to their complex programs.
    2. Confirmation: Provide evidence of ownership and identification.
    3. Replacement Process: A new key is bought, cut, and programmed to sync with the automobile.

    Often Asked Questions

    1. For how long does it take to replace a Volkswagen key?

    Generally, changing a key can take anywhere from 30 minutes to numerous hours, depending upon the kind of key and whether you have an existing key that requires duplication.

    2. Can I replace my Volkswagen key myself?

    While cutting and setting keys may appear uncomplicated, it’s often best to seek advice from a professional for transponder and smart keys due to their complexities and security features.

    3. What should I do if I’ve lost all my keys?

    If all keys are lost, you will need to supply your VIN to the dealership or a licensed locksmith, together with ownership confirmation, to start the replacement procedure.

    4. Is it cheaper to get a key made at a dealership?

    While car dealership rates might be higher, they ensure compatibility and may provide exact cutting and programs for vehicles, specifically newer designs.
